HOW TO USE THE MANUAL MODE

1 Begin pedaling to activate the console.

The exercise cycle requires no batteries or external power source. Power is supplied by

a generator as you pedal.To activate the con-

sole, begin pedaling at a speed of about 3 miles

per hour or faster. After a few seconds, the con- sole displays will light. A tone will then sound and the console will be ready for use.

2 Select the manual mode.

When the power is turned on, the

manual mode will be selected. If you have selected a

program or the iFIT.com mode,

select the manual mode by pressing the Program Select button repeatedly until a track appears in the matrix.

Begin pedaling and change the resistance of

3 the exercise cycle as desired.

As you pedal,

change the resis- tance of the exer- cise cycle by pressing the Resistance but-

tons. There are

ten resistance levels. Note: After the Resistance buttons are pressed, it will take a moment for the exercise cycle to reach the selected resistance level.

Monitor your progress with the matrix, the

4 Training Zone bar, and the two displays.

The matrix — When the manual mode or the iFIT.com mode is selected, the matrix will show a

track representing 1/4 mile. As you exercise, the

indicators around the tr ack will light, one at a time, until the entire track is lit. When you have completed a lap, a new lap will begin.

The Training Zone bar —The Training Zone bar will show your pace and the approximate inten-

sity level of your exercise. For exam-

ple, if three or four indicators in the bar are lit, the bar shows that your pace is ideal for fat burning. During programs, the Training Zone bar will also

prompt you to increase or decrease your pace.

The left display

The left display will

 

show the elapsed

 

time, your pedaling

 

pace (measured in

 

minutes per mile

),

and the distance

 

you have pedaled. The display will change from one number to the next every few seconds, as shown by the indicators around the display. Note: When a program is selected, the display will show the time remaining in the program and the time remaining in the current segment of the program instead of the elapsed time.

The right

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

display

—The right

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

display will show

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

your pedaling

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

speed, the approxi-

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

mate numbers of

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

fat calories

and

 

 

 

calories

you have burned (see FAT BURNING on

 

 

 

page 23), and the resistance level of the exercise cycle. The display will change from one number to the next every few seconds, as shown by the indi- cators. The display will also show your heart rate when you use the handgrip pulse sensor or the optional chest pulse sensor. Note: Each time the resistance of the exercise cycle changes, the dis- play will show the resistance level.
